Description
Mabu Jila is an app for sharing and securing short videos of traditional Kimberley culture. It allows you to make your profile, explore your culture, and safely upload videos. All videos are uploaded with cultural protocols, so that videos are stored the right way and can only be seen by the right people.
Collaborate and share with others to keep culture strong. Culture is Now.
Mabu Jila is owned and managed by the Kimberley Aboriginal Law and Cultural Centre (KALACC), and was developed under the authority of the senior cultural bosses of the Kimberley. Access to certain areas of the app require a special invite code, so speak to an elder, cultural authority or KALACC staff member to learn how you can access Mabu Jila.
